Achieving a flawless skin appearance requires more than just good genes—it necessitates a committed beauty care regimen. Since the skin is our most expansive organ, it encounters numerous external aggressors, UV rays, and other factors that affect its health and appearance. An everyday practice that includes cleansing, moisturizing, treatment masks, serums, and pure oils is essential to keeping skin that remains youthful and resilient.
Daily cleansing lays the groundwork for a successful beauty regimen. Over time, the surface gathers impurities, sebum, and pollutants, which, if not removed, can lead to breakouts, lack of radiance, and skin issues. A good face wash removes these deposits, making sure a clean skin surface. Yet, one must to use a mild cleanser suited for one’s skin type to prevent irritation. Cleansers with strong chemicals can deplete essential moisture, leading to inflammation. Individuals prone to irritation must choose hypoallergenic formulas. People prone to shine should consider gel-based washes that deeply clean without excessive dryness. Nourishing face washes work best for dehydrated skin, ensuring moisture retention.
Post-cleansing, using a moisturizer is the next crucial step to lock in moisture. Hydrating lotions work to restore moisture, preventing flakiness or sensitivity. Regardless of skin condition, hydration is necessary. Those with excess oil production benefit from lightweight hydrators that maintain elasticity without greasiness. Dehydrated skin types, a richer product is more effective. People with fluctuating skin needs demands a mix check here of textures that neither overwhelm nor under-hydrate. With consistent use, hydration-focused care ensures youthful plumpness.
Pure oils are highly recommended because they provide deep hydration. Compared to lotions and creams, beauty oils penetrate deeper to enhance intense nourishment. Oils like squalane oil, that are rich in essential fatty acids, improve skin elasticity. For individuals with excessive sebum, non-comedogenic options including grapeseed moisturize without clogging pores. Skin prone to dehydration see the most results with richer oils including marula, which restore moisture. Adding a beauty oil as a final step helps lock in hydration, giving soft, healthy-looking skin.
